Hi
I am trying to bond a small piece of flat 2mm pre oreg carbon fibre to the side of a 5mm diameter carbon fibre rod and want to know what the strongest possible bonding method I should use.
The part once finished will have daily force put on it so really needs to be super strong.
I am considering using the ET-500 adhesive but not sure if that would be strong enough.
Any advice?

As Dravis said,
VuduGlu™ VM100 Black
is a great choice. However if you need something with less odour then our
PT326 20min Rigid Polyurethane Adhesive Twin Tube
is a very good alternative.
Remember to give both surfaces a good key and degrease to achieve the best bond. Also where the bonding surface area is small, it can help to use "fillets" of adhesive to increase the bonding surface area and hence bond strength.
